I'm simply talking about a more ``smarter'' sender identification
algorithm, because i don't need the S/MIME (is too much for me), but i
will appreciate a better sender identification.

Sympa simply consider from, so the sender is what written in From:
header, easyly forged.

Smartlist do more accurate header scanning, and the sender is 99.9% the
real sender of the email.


I'm simply asking if someone have noted this before, and if someone
have tried to port the ``smarter'' sender identification algorithm of
smartlist to sympa.

The algorithm works with:

:0
* 9876543210^0 foreign_submit ?? y
* 2^0 ? formail -X"From " -xFrom: -xReply-To: -xSender: -xResent-From: \
-xResent-Reply-To: -xResent-Sender: -xReturn-Path: | \
multigram -b1 -m -l$submit_threshold -L$domain \
-x$listaddr -x$listreq accept accept2
{


so the smartness are all into the multigram binary (i suppose you know
a little procmail).


I hope that now i'm clear.
